Samsung Refrigerator Error Code 86
COMP OVER-VOLTAGE ERROR
What the 86 error code actually means
Your Samsung refrigerator has detected that the electrical voltage powering its compressor is too high, or that a small sensing component on the control board has failed. Either situation causes the refrigerator to shut down the compressor to protect it from damage. A technician will need to inspect the board and your home's power supply to find the exact cause.

Most common causes of 86
- 1Shorted DCLINK resistor (R514, R515, or R516)
- 2High or unstable AC supply voltage
- 3Failed inverter control board
- 4Power surge or transient voltage spike
